- Annual Energy Use
- 645 kWh/year
- Federal Energy Standard
- This model uses 645 kWh/year, which is 13% less energy than the U.S. federal standard of 732 kWh/year for its size class. (Source: EPA Energy Star Certified Products Database, data.energystar.gov)
- Estimated Annual Operating Cost
- Based on EIA rate data tracked by Fridge.com, this model costs approximately $117/year to operate at the national average residential electricity rate of 18.07¢/kWh. Operating cost varies by state: approximately $80/year in LA (12.39¢/kWh) to $274/year in HI (42.49¢/kWh). (Source: EIA residential electricity rates, January 2026, analyzed by Fridge.com)
- Estimated Annual Carbon Footprint
- According to EPA eGRID data analyzed by Fridge.com, this model produces approximately 528 lbs of CO2 per year at the national grid average. Carbon footprint varies significantly by state grid mix: approximately 14 lbs/year in VT (clean grid) to 1176 lbs/year in WV (coal-heavy grid). (Source: EPA eGRID 2022 state emission factors, analyzed by Fridge.com)
